项目部署到服务器上是什么意思,项目部署到服务器上的全过程解析与实操指南
- 综合资讯
- 2025-03-18 13:20:09
- 4

项目部署到服务器上,即把项目从本地环境迁移到服务器运行,全过程包括选择服务器、配置环境、上传代码、配置数据库、测试等步骤,本文将详细解析部署流程,并提供实操指南,帮助读...
项目部署到服务器上,即把项目从本地环境迁移到服务器运行,全过程包括选择服务器、配置环境、上传代码、配置数据库、测试等步骤,本文将详细解析部署流程,并提供实操指南,帮助读者顺利将项目部署到服务器。
随着互联网技术的飞速发展,越来越多的企业和个人开始关注项目部署到服务器上的问题,项目部署到服务器上,即是指将开发完成的项目程序、数据库等资源部署到服务器上,使其能够在互联网上稳定、高效地运行,本文将从项目部署到服务器上的概念、流程、注意事项以及实操指南等方面进行详细解析。
项目部署到服务器上的概念
项目部署到服务器上,是指将开发完成的项目程序、数据库、配置文件等资源上传到服务器,使其在服务器上运行,并通过互联网供用户访问,项目部署到服务器上主要包括以下内容:
-
硬件环境:服务器硬件配置,如CPU、内存、硬盘等。
图片来源于网络,如有侵权联系删除
-
软件环境:操作系统、数据库、开发语言运行环境等。
-
项目程序:开发完成的项目程序文件。
-
配置文件:项目运行所需的配置文件。
-
数据库:项目运行所需的数据存储。
项目部署到服务器上的流程
准备工作
(1)选择合适的云服务器或物理服务器。
(2)配置服务器硬件环境,如安装操作系统、数据库、开发语言运行环境等。
(3)准备项目程序、配置文件和数据库。
部署项目程序
(1)登录服务器,使用SSH工具连接到服务器。
(2)创建项目目录,并将项目程序文件上传到服务器。
(3)设置项目目录的权限,确保项目程序具有执行权限。
(4)编译项目程序,生成可执行文件。
配置项目环境
(1)修改配置文件,设置项目运行所需的参数。
(2)配置数据库连接信息,确保项目能够连接到数据库。
(3)配置网络参数,如防火墙、端口映射等。
部署数据库
(1)登录数据库服务器,创建数据库。
(2)将项目数据库文件上传到数据库服务器。
(3)导入数据库文件,创建数据库表。
测试项目
(1)在服务器上启动项目程序。
图片来源于网络,如有侵权联系删除
(2)通过浏览器访问项目,测试项目功能。
(3)根据测试结果,调整项目配置和数据库。
优化项目
(1)对项目进行性能优化,提高项目运行效率。
(2)对服务器进行优化,提高服务器性能。
(3)配置自动化部署工具,实现项目自动部署。
项目部署到服务器上的注意事项
-
服务器安全:确保服务器安全,防止黑客攻击。
-
数据备份:定期备份项目程序、配置文件和数据库,以防数据丢失。
-
负载均衡:合理配置负载均衡,提高项目访问速度。
-
监控与报警:设置服务器监控,实时监控项目运行状态,及时发现问题。
-
网络优化:优化网络配置,提高项目访问速度。
项目部署到服务器的实操指南
-
选择合适的云服务器或物理服务器。
-
安装操作系统,如CentOS、Ubuntu等。
-
安装数据库,如MySQL、PostgreSQL等。
-
安装开发语言运行环境,如Java、PHP、Python等。
-
上传项目程序、配置文件和数据库。
-
部署项目程序,配置项目环境。
-
部署数据库,测试项目。
-
优化项目,配置自动化部署工具。
项目部署到服务器上是确保项目在互联网上稳定、高效运行的关键环节,通过以上解析和实操指南,相信您已经对项目部署到服务器有了更深入的了解,在实际操作过程中,请务必注意安全、备份、优化等方面,确保项目成功部署到服务器上。
本文链接:https://www.zhitaoyun.cn/1825424.html
发表评论